The Naples Beach Hotel & Golf Club History
The Naples Beach Hotel & Golf Club has a rich history in the Southwest Florida region. The hotel was originally constructed in the 1880s and was aptly named The Naples Hotel. The hotel was built two blocks east of the Naples fishing pier and 1.5 miles south of what would eventually become the current location for The Naples Beach Hotel & Golf Club. Historically, guests predominately from the Midwest, arrived for the "season" in December and returned home in the spring.

In 1929, Allen Joslin (married to the heir of the Jergens hand lotion fortune) and wife Lois, built the first 18-hole golf course in the area. He obtained the adjacent beachfront property where he built The Beach Club - the first building at the site of what would become The Naples Beach Hotel & Golf Club.

In late 1946, Henry B. Watkins, Sr., a 56-year-old retired toy manufacturer from Ohio, bought the original hotel along with The Beach Club with its golf course. Watkins, Sr. then proceeded to create a new beach resort between the golf course and the Gulf of Mexico - the site of the current resort.
